This morning, July 24th, we headed out again to the same WMA. We hit up the same little mudhole 1st, with no ducks this time, and headed up the next hill. Brandi was acting a little goofy, but then started rolling in something. Roxi was doing her own thing and I looked over to see her on point. She can be a naughty little mouse pointer, but I was pretty sure her head was up too high for that. She held steady, and soon enough a little hen bust from the cover off of her right flank, and I managed to get a shot...a camera shot that is. Half a minute later, a young rooster rose a ways in front of me, in an area I knew Brandi had made it too. I have a good feeling the youngster birds had been together and parted ways, trying to make a run for it.
